Dr Mitchell calls Cameron’s response Amazing Disrespect

Fri, Nov 20, '15

 

WICB Under Scrutiny

ROSEAU, Dominica (CMC) – Grenada’s Prime Minister Dr Keith Mitchell on Thursday slammed what he called an “amazing level of disrespect” on the part of West Indies Cricket Board president Dave Cameron, as pressure continued to mount on the beleaguered Board to meet urgently with Caricom leaders over the Governance Review Panel report.

Mitchell, the chairman of Caricom’s Cricket Governance Committee, stopped short of issuing an ultimatum to the WICB but urged Cameron to rethink his decision not to accommodate a meeting with regional Heads before the Board of Directors meeting on December 12 in St Lucia.

Cameron has been adamant about the WICB’s inability to accommodate the Caribbean leaders prior to the already scheduled meeting and reiterated this position in written communication to Caricom Secretary-General Irwin LaRocque on Tuesday.

“It is quite amazing the level of disrespect. The level of lack of understanding of the importance of this is quite frightening and I don’t think I should hold back any words,” Mitchell said bluntly, as he spoke on the last day of the OECS Summit here.
